Achievements

  • Co-founded and led FutureAdvisor, a digital wealth management platform acquired by BlackRock in 2015
  • Recognized as a World Economic Forum Tech Pioneer in 2015
  • Holds two patents on mobile computing and social signals from Microsoft
  • Graduated with Highest Honors in Computer Science from University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ign
  • Served as COO of healthcare startup Clipboard Health
  • Part of Y Combinator S10 batch in 2010
